Description

Views, Views and More

Spacious, sun filled one bedroom with North and West views highlighted by the Empire State and Chrysler buildings. The entry foyer leads to a generous living rm and dining area. The updated, windowed kitchen features beautiful white lacquered cabinets, stone counter tops with abundant storage space.

The corner bedroom has double exposures with bright light streaming throughout. Additionally the windowed bathroom is complemented with beautiful subway tiles.

242 E.19th St., is a premier prewar coop in the Gramercy. Apt. #11E is quite special in that it features 9.5 Ft beamed ceilings, oversized windows, thru wall A/C and beautiful hardwood floors.

An additional plus is that electricity and gas are included in your maintenance. This is a Full Service Co-op with 24 hour doorman, a Resident Manager, bike room and separate storage (for rent) and a beautifully landscaped common roof deck.

Pets are permitted with board approval. Co purchasing and guarantors are allowed. Subletting is permitted.

242 is within close proximity to Union Square, Stuyvesant Park, multiple subway lines and all the Gramercy neighborhood has to offer.
